Key Strategies to Elevate Your Sales Game


1. Streamline Your Sales Process

A clear and structured process eliminates confusion.

✔ Define each stage of the funnel

✔ Remove unnecessary steps

✔ Standardize workflows

πŸ’‘ Result: Faster deal cycles and better consistency.


2. Leverage Technology and CRM

Your CRM should be your command center.

Use it to:

  • Track leads and deals
  • Monitor customer interactions
  • Automate follow-ups

πŸ‘‰ A well-used CRM = better visibility and control.

 In recent years, the rise of blockchain technology has transformed everything from payments to logistics. But one of its most groundbreaking applications lies in the world of tokenized trading — where real-world and digital assets are converted into blockchain-based tokens that can be bought, sold, or traded just like traditional securities. What Is Tokenized Trading? Tokenized trading refers to the conversion of real-world assets (like stocks, bonds, real estate, or commodities) into digital tokens on a blockchain. These tokens represent ownership and can be fractionalized, making previously illiquid or expensive assets more accessible. Imagine owning a fraction of a luxury apartment in Manhattan or a piece of fine art by simply buying a token. That’s the power of tokenization — it democratizes access and opens up new possibilities for investors and institutions alike .
